Output 8af50206b8f4cc265c2382bb0f842dc66a73fd79eda8b19f03ff3020449f0108:4

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9f1e50c1e702e910a6f5667899e9d1693c68430 OP_EQUAL
address
ACJf5A2ck66a9pzoSCLqRtPmeFv94KL5Cr
transaction
8af50206b8f4cc265c2382bb0f842dc66a73fd79eda8b19f03ff3020449f0108